Exports by Country

Germany (X square meters) was the main destination for curtains exports from the Czech Republic, with a X% share of total exports. Moreover, curtains exports to Germany exceeded the volume sent to the second major destination, the Netherlands (X square meters), ninefold. Poland (X square meters) ranked third in terms of total exports with a X% share.

From 2012 to 2022, the average annual rate of growth in terms of volume to Germany amounted to X%. Exports to the other major destinations recorded the following average annual rates of exports growth: the Netherlands (X% per year) and Poland (X% per year).

In value terms, the largest markets for curtains exported from the Czech Republic were Germany ($X), the Netherlands ($X) and Belgium ($X), with a combined X% share of total exports. Denmark, France, Sweden, Hungary, Slovakia and Poland l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further X%.

In terms of the main countries of destination, Sweden, with a CAGR of X%, recorded the highest growth rate of the value of exports, over the period under review, while shipments for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

Imports by Country

Poland (X square meters), Germany (X square meters) and Turkey (X square meters) were the main suppliers of curtains imports to the Czech Republic, with a combined X% share of total imports. Vietnam, China, the Netherlands and Austria l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further X%.

From 2012 to 2022, the biggest increases were recorded for Vietnam (with a CAGR of X%), while purchases for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

In value terms, Poland ($X), Germany ($X) and China ($X) were the largest curtains suppliers to the Czech Republic, with a combined X% share of total imports.

Among the main suppliers, Poland, with a CAGR of X%, recorded the highest rates of growth with regard to the value of imports, over the period under review, while purchases for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

The countries with the highest volumes of consumption in 2023 were China, the United States and India, with a combined 46% share of global consumption. Indonesia, Pakistan, the UK, Bangladesh, Germany, Japan, France, Ethiopia, Democratic Republic of the Congo and Iran lagged somewhat behind, together comprising a further 24%.
The country with the largest volume of curtains production was China, accounting for 53% of total volume. Moreover, curtains production in China ex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est producer, India, sixfold. The third position in this ranking was held by Mexico, with a 3.9% share.
In value terms, Poland, Germany and China were the largest curtains suppliers to the Czech Republic, together comprising 73% of total imports.
In value terms, Germany, the Netherlands and Belgium constituted the largest markets for curtains exported from the Czech Republic worldwide, with a combined 73% share of total exports. Denmark, France, Sweden, Hungary, Slovakia and Poland l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further 17%.
The average curtains export price stood at $10 per square meter in 2022, dropping by -8.1% against the previous year.
In 2022, the average curtains import price amounted to $3.1 per square meter, with an increase of 7.2% against the previous year.
